Accelerating the Silicon Race

In a significant move that underscores the intensifying global competition for AI supremacy, Huawei announced at its recent Huawei Connect conference that it is fast-tracking the launch of its next-generation Ascend 960DT AI chip. Originally slated for a third-quarter debut in 2027, the company has updated its timeline, now targeting a rollout in the first quarter of the year. This aggressive scheduling is part of a broader strategy to establish a robust, independent AI hardware ecosystem capable of rivaling Western tech giants, despite the ongoing shadow of international trade restrictions and semiconductor export controls.

Company officials emphasized that the Ascend 960DT is a critical component of their iterative development cycle. By accelerating the release, Huawei aims to deliver double the performance of previous generations, maintaining a steady cadence of innovation that keeps pace with the rapid evolution of large-scale AI training and inference requirements.

The Peerium Computing Architecture

At the heart of Huawei’s strategy is the newly unveiled Peerium Computing Architecture. This framework is designed to move beyond the constraints of traditional localized processing by enabling the interconnection of hundreds of thousands of AI accelerators into a unified, massive computational fabric. By leveraging Huawei’s proprietary UnifiedBus technology—which facilitates high-speed communication between processors, memory, and networking hardware—the company intends to treat vast arrays of silicon as a single, giant computer.

The first implementations of this architecture are found in the Atlas 950 SuperPoD and the expansive SuperCluster systems. Huawei claims that the SuperCluster can link up to 256,000 individual accelerator cards. While industry analysts have noted some discrepancies between early conceptual scaling projections and the hardware configurations recently presented, the ambition remains clear: to build the infrastructure necessary to power the next wave of foundational models.

Why It Matters

  • Strategic Autonomy: As geopolitical tensions influence global supply chains, Huawei’s push for self-sufficiency in high-performance computing represents a major shift in how China approaches critical tech infrastructure.
  • Scalability Challenges: While the move to Peerium allows for massive potential scale, the actual deployment density remains a point of debate among industry watchers, balancing theoretical capacity against practical thermal and power management.
  • Geopolitical Context: The announcement follows high-level diplomatic discussions between the U.S. and China, highlighting how silicon-level advancements are now inextricably linked to national economic and security strategies.

Future Outlook and Implications

The push for the Ascend 960DT comes at a time when the stakes for AI development have never been higher. Huawei’s leadership has indicated that domestic companies must rapidly scale their computing power to fully understand the complexities and risks of emerging artificial intelligence. By prioritizing the production of advanced AI chips, Huawei is not only seeking to support local enterprise needs but also to ensure that China’s technological progress is not hindered by limitations in physical computing hardware. As the market looks toward 2027, the success of the Ascend series will likely serve as a litmus test for the effectiveness of self-reliant semiconductor strategies in an era of global tech fragmentation.
